Product Overview
The XL-3216SURUGC is a XINGLIGHT red green bi-color SMD LED built in a compact 3216 package. Its outline dimensions are 3.2 x 1.6 x 0.8 mm with a transparent colloid lens structure. The component is specified for high brightness red and green output and a typical 120 degree viewing angle at IF=20mA and Ta=25°C.
Electrical ratings include 20 mA forward working current for both colors, 5 V reverse voltage for both colors, and 80 mA peak forward current under pulse conditions of pulse width <=0.1 ms and duty <=1/10. Typical light intensity is 150 mcd for red and 550 mcd for green at IF=20mA.
The LED is suitable for SMT automatic production and reflow soldering. Handling data includes MSL 3, a maximum of two reflow cycles, recommended maximum soldering temperature of 240±5°C for 6 s, and opened-package storage of 30°C or less, less than 40%RH, with soldering within 168 hours.

FAQ
What package size does XL-3216SURUGC use?
XL-3216SURUGC uses a 3216 SMD package with outline dimensions of 3.2 x 1.6 x 0.8 mm. The datasheet lists an outline dimension tolerance of ±0.25 mm unless otherwise noted.
What are the red and green optical ratings?
At IF=20mA and Ta=25°C, red luminous intensity is typically 150 mcd and green luminous intensity is typically 550 mcd. Dominant wavelength is 615-625 nm for red and 520-530 nm for green.
Is XL-3216SURUGC compatible with reflow soldering?
The datasheet states that XL-3216SURUGC is suitable for reflow soldering and SMT automatic production. The recommended maximum soldering temperature is 240±5°C for 6 s, and the maximum reflow count is no more than two times.
What storage controls apply after opening the package?
After opening, storage should be 30°C or less and less than 40%RH, with soldering within 168 hours, or 7 days. If storage time is exceeded or the desiccant faded, baking is specified at 60±5°C for 24 hours.
